Edith Irvine was the cofounder of the Black Angus Steakhouse chain. She loved traveling and sailing, and in the 1970s, she fought to remain a member of the Seattle Yacht Club after her divorce. Women typically weren’t allowed as members without their husbands, but Irvine challenged the standard and the yacht club changed it for hood.
Obituary
Edie was loving, kind, beautiful and a joy and inspiration to all who met her… Edie traveled the world, worked hard and became co-founder of several restaurants including the Black Angus chain with her former husband, Stuart Anderson. She also owned a designer boutique in Palm Sprongs with her husband, Tab Kirkman.
